I cut my little spouts off when it is still setting up, so its still kinda soft. Makes it a bit easier to do. Good job on the toys!

Depending on the size you can usually grab the sprout with pliers and twist it off. Also don't cut towards you if your finger is in the way. My dad is like Grand Champion of that.
